About the Book

Table of Contents:
Introduction: The reason: the competence catastrophe Chapter 1: The human species is capable of learning Chapter 2: We can learn, but we cannot be taught Chapter 3: Learning is not mediated, but appropriated Chapter 4: We learn from others, but we think alone Chapter 5: Learning is less preparation and more identity formation Chapter 6: Education is about seeking, not finding Chapter 7: Self-study skills are the key to change Chapter 8: A new understanding of learning and how to promote it Chapter 9: Self-learning requires appreciation, guidance, stimulating arrangements, and support Chapter 10: Skills development requires a guide for educational institutions Conclusion: The outlook: Journey to the age of self-structured learning Bibliography Author biography

About the Author :
Rolf Arnold, PhD, obtained his doctorate at the University of Heidelberg, Germany, in 1983 and his postdoctoral qualification at the Distance Univerity of Hagen, Germany, in 1987. Since 1990, he has been Professor of Pedagogy (Vocational and Adult Education) at Technische Universität Kaiserslautern, Germany. He is also Scientific Director of the Distance and Independent Studies Centre (DISC), Kaiserslautern, Germany, and speaker of the Virtual Campus Rhineland-Palatinate (VCRP).

Review :
Many European and non-European countries, such as Germany, are racing into a momentous educational catastrophe almost unchecked: a competence catastrophe. Instead of nurturing learner competencies, such as creativity and self-directed learning, some educational organizations continue to favor traditional forms of learning, even in the face of digitization, employing what the author refers to as mediation logic that has no backing from modern research evidence in neuroscience and learning research. If the competence catastrophe can be stopped at all, then a courageous train of thought, such as that of Rolf Arnold presented in this book, requires implementation in pedagogical practice! The concept presented in this book by Rolf Arnold provides, among other things, important foundations for understanding the development of diversity competence in education: A self-organized development process facilitated through an enabling educational framework. Doubts, contradictions and confusions are addressed in this book, which promotes an educational framework that targets competence development, including understanding the didactical process of assisting learner competence to systematically cope with the experience of experiencing, but also wider competencies such as the ability to cope with cognitive, but also emotional dissonance.
